   ### What problem does this PR solve?
   publishExecutors is a static field, but the constructor appends new thread 
pools on every invocation without checking if they already exist.
   
   The constructor is called each time a new Env instance is created, which 
happens periodically during Env checkpoint/journal replay (the checkpoint 
thread creates a new Env to replay the journal). Each call appends 
publish_thread_pool_num (default 128) pools to the static list, causing 
unbounded growth.
   
   Heap dump analysis (branch-4.0, 12 rounds of p0 regression) confirmed:
   
   ThreadPoolExecutor: R1: 2,506 → R12: 12,236 (+388.3%), 11/11 strictly 
increasing
   dbExecutors backing array grew to Object[11070] (~86 Env replays × 128 pools)
   Each leaked pool retains threads, locks, and condition queues
